Output de5855060641e4eaf34fe6969afd7eb7ec6d60e8965bef7ab64bdbb8cfbcd5c2:1

value
45608662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dd88dfd2c4b58a5a2e89793d274b6f1b673cbfa OP_EQUAL
address
32xE8Wzt13aP8zKNCa7PiTqRoeXuurSbhK
transaction
de5855060641e4eaf34fe6969afd7eb7ec6d60e8965bef7ab64bdbb8cfbcd5c2
confirmations
375111
spent
true